Transaction d35cd8086f361c134a49b9017059f72c12a23019e9e385d2987821a75b6a3216
1 Input
2 Outputs
- d35cd8086f361c134a49b9017059f72c12a23019e9e385d2987821a75b6a3216:0
- d35cd8086f361c134a49b9017059f72c12a23019e9e385d2987821a75b6a3216:1
value 1046049
address 1L8wKnrCQo9zPxiHXWgEkMaWrMHCF7Yu8n
value 3942575
address 18tUVX5qfQ1FvzQDLpYFFiXLM66B2m3i9a